I came across her Christmas Eve in Catford Market. The line was, her baby had just died and she needed money for flowers for the funeral. I asked her when the funeral was, at first she said in a month's time, then she said two weeks time.
I could hear her telling another woman who later passed by that she needed money for baby formula milk.
